| | Re: Import folders from Outlook Express to Windows Vista "Sharon Savoy" <redwing1951@xxxxxx> wrote in message news:uQofATRiIHA.1204@xxxxxx Quote: > Could you please help me import my folders from Outlook express to Windows > Vista Mail? I have them saved on my hard drive but can't open them. > Thank you. > > Sharon <http://www.vista4beginners.com/Migrate-from-Outlook-Express-to-Windows-Mail> If you want your old contacts, bring along the .wab file. After you copy the files to a directory on your new hard drive, but before you import them into Windows Mail, make sure the copies are read-write instead of readonly. |
